From the famed mystery writer, Carl Addison Swanson, comes a touching story of the "Wonder Years", the summer of 1960 in Westport, Connecticut. Follow the exploits of the Alfred E. Newman look-a-like, Justin Carmichael, in his coming of age saga and the ups and downs of being twelve years old in a changing world. The novel will make you laugh, cry and remember the trying times of growing up and your first love. A must read for any member of the Boomer Generation and a good glimpse for any reader to the realities of our past.

Carl Addison Swanson is the award-winning author of the Hush McCormick series featuring Pig in a Poke, Sorry Don't Pay the Bulldog, and Fat People Are Harder to Kidnap. The latter is soon to be a major motion picture. After decades living in Texas, Carl Addison Swanson has returned to live in his home town of Westport, Connecticut, to write.
